Last week I had a problem after changing the souce type of a member from RPGLE
to SQLRPGLE using the properties function for the source member in the RSE
filter.
After suggestions from the list, I found the member in the
RemoteSystemsTempFiles folder, deleted it and then was able to open it normally.
Well, it just happened again at another account (also after installing fix pack
8.0.2) and I looked further into it.
It appears that the file in the RemoteSystemsTempFiles folder had its suffix
changed to sqlRPGLE.  I changed it to SQLRPGLE, and was then able to open the
source member normally.

I think this is a bug in RDP.
